Curiosity Rover on Mars Leaves Landing 'Safe Zone' The 1-ton Curiosity rover has now cruised out of its landing ellipse, the area -- about 4 miles wide by 12 miles long (7 by 20 kilometers) -- regarded as safe ground for its August 2012 touchdown within Mars' huge Gale Crater, NASA officials said.
